Is Atkinson, NE a Good Place to Live?
Atkinson receives an overall livability grade of B+ (78/100), placing it among the better areas in Nebraska. Safety scores B+ (71/100). Affordability scores A (82/100) with a median household income of $67,083 and median home values around $166,700.
About 31.2% of residents hold a bachelor's degree or higher, and the unemployment rate is 2.9%. 75% of housing is owner-occupied. The median age is 44.
